Subject: Re: [Qemu-devel] [PATCH 2/4] qapi: output visitor crashes qemu if it encounters a NULL value

> > >>> A NULL value is not added to visitor's stack, but there is no
> > >>> check for that when the visitor tries to return that value,
> > >>> leading to Qemu crash.

> > Can/should that be addressed as a follow-up? Or is there a test case
> > that breaks?
> Simple and "popular" test case: the user does not use the -kernel-cmdline parameter.
> The patch is needed because otherwise the main function will fail
> if no value is passed by the user to string parameters.
>
> Regarding Luiz's concern, it can be a follow-up as I am not aware of
> any problem with that.
My concern was that I wasn't sure if this is the right fix for the issue
or if it's papering over the real bug. I quickly checked the code and it
seemed to make sense, but I didn't have time to study it deeper.
We could ask Michael Roth or Anthony, but I wouldn't hold this series
because of that. Here's my ACK if you need it:
